For Damon Young, existing while black is an extreme sport. The act of possessing black skin while searching for space to breathe in America is enough to induce a ceaseless state of angst, where questions such as "How should I react here, as a Professional Black Person?" and "Will this white person's potato salad kill me?" are forever relevant.
Both a celebration of the idiosyncrasies and distinctions of blackness and a critique of white supremacy and how we define masculinity,
What Doesn't Kill You Makes You Blacker is a hilarious and honest debut that chronicles Young's efforts to survive while battling and making sense of the various neuroses his country has given him.
